summaryrefslogtreecommitdiffhomepage
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/driver/pe_driver_ctx.c6
-rw-r--r--src/driver/pe_unit_ctx.c6
-rw-r--r--src/internal/argv/argv.h2
-rw-r--r--src/internal/perk_output_impl.h6
-rw-r--r--src/internal/perk_reader_impl.h6
-rw-r--r--src/logic/pe_get_image_meta.c6
-rw-r--r--src/logic/pe_map_raw_image.c6
-rw-r--r--src/output/pe_output_export_symbols.c6
-rw-r--r--src/output/pe_output_import_libraries.c6
-rw-r--r--src/perk.c6
-rw-r--r--src/reader/pe_read_coff_header.c6
-rw-r--r--src/reader/pe_read_dos_header.c6
-rw-r--r--src/reader/pe_read_export_header.c6
-rw-r--r--src/reader/pe_read_import_header.c6
-rw-r--r--src/reader/pe_read_optional_header.c6
-rw-r--r--src/reader/pe_read_section_header.c6
16 files changed, 91 insertions, 1 deletions
diff --git a/src/driver/pe_driver_ctx.c b/src/driver/pe_driver_ctx.c
index 7ef837e..ff92c1d 100644
--- a/src/driver/pe_driver_ctx.c
+++ b/src/driver/pe_driver_ctx.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<stdint.h>
#include <unistd.h>
#include <fcntl.h>
diff --git a/src/driver/pe_unit_ctx.c b/src/driver/pe_unit_ctx.c
index 40b2a33..2b05707 100644
--- a/src/driver/pe_unit_ctx.c
+++ b/src/driver/pe_unit_ctx.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<stdint.h>
#include <stddef.h>
#include <stdlib.h>
diff --git a/src/internal/argv/argv.h b/src/internal/argv/argv.h
index dff42d5..6f26d56 100644
--- a/src/internal/argv/argv.h
+++ b/src/internal/argv/argv.h
@@ -1,6 +1,6 @@
/****************************************************************************/
/* argv.h: a thread-safe argument vector parser and usage screen generator */
-/* Copyright (C) 2015 Z. Gilboa */
+/* Copyright (C) 2015--2016 Z. Gilboa */
/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
/* This file is (also) part of sofort: portable software project template. */
/****************************************************************************/
diff --git a/src/internal/perk_output_impl.h b/src/internal/perk_output_impl.h
index 0fd3c53..cb8b304 100644
--- a/src/internal/perk_output_impl.h
+++ b/src/internal/perk_output_impl.h
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#ifndef PE_OUTPUT_IMPL_H
#define PE_OUTPUT_IMPL_H
diff --git a/src/internal/perk_reader_impl.h b/src/internal/perk_reader_impl.h
index 9098561..24fc38c 100644
--- a/src/internal/perk_reader_impl.h
+++ b/src/internal/perk_reader_impl.h
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#ifndef PERK_READER_IMPL_H
#define PERK_READER_IMPL_H
diff --git a/src/logic/pe_get_image_meta.c b/src/logic/pe_get_image_meta.c
index 699b3a2..f4adfbe 100644
--- a/src/logic/pe_get_image_meta.c
+++ b/src/logic/pe_get_image_meta.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<stdint.h>
#include <stdlib.h>
#include <stdio.h>
diff --git a/src/logic/pe_map_raw_image.c b/src/logic/pe_map_raw_image.c
index 98cf584..d28ecb6 100644
--- a/src/logic/pe_map_raw_image.c
+++ b/src/logic/pe_map_raw_image.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<stdint.h>
#include <stdbool.h>
#include <unistd.h>
diff --git a/src/output/pe_output_export_symbols.c b/src/output/pe_output_export_symbols.c
index 4ff8d57..94d0037 100644
--- a/src/output/pe_output_export_symbols.c
+++ b/src/output/pe_output_export_symbols.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<stdint.h>
#include <stdlib.h>
#include <stdio.h>
diff --git a/src/output/pe_output_import_libraries.c b/src/output/pe_output_import_libraries.c
index be46d1f..3b71018 100644
--- a/src/output/pe_output_import_libraries.c
+++ b/src/output/pe_output_import_libraries.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<stdint.h>
#include <stdlib.h>
#include <stdio.h>
diff --git a/src/perk.c b/src/perk.c
index 579e0fc..82a3235 100644
--- a/src/perk.c
+++ b/src/perk.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<stdio.h>
#include <unistd.h>
#include <perk/perk.h>
diff --git a/src/reader/pe_read_coff_header.c b/src/reader/pe_read_coff_header.c
index a0a0b7f..4df53c4 100644
--- a/src/reader/pe_read_coff_header.c
+++ b/src/reader/pe_read_coff_header.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<endian.h>
#include <string.h>
diff --git a/src/reader/pe_read_dos_header.c b/src/reader/pe_read_dos_header.c
index 078cf56..53faf55 100644
--- a/src/reader/pe_read_dos_header.c
+++ b/src/reader/pe_read_dos_header.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<endian.h>
#include <string.h>
diff --git a/src/reader/pe_read_export_header.c b/src/reader/pe_read_export_header.c
index a2ab19a..544c3a4 100644
--- a/src/reader/pe_read_export_header.c
+++ b/src/reader/pe_read_export_header.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<endian.h>
#include <string.h>
diff --git a/src/reader/pe_read_import_header.c b/src/reader/pe_read_import_header.c
index de5730b..14dbf39 100644
--- a/src/reader/pe_read_import_header.c
+++ b/src/reader/pe_read_import_header.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<endian.h>
#include <string.h>
diff --git a/src/reader/pe_read_optional_header.c b/src/reader/pe_read_optional_header.c
index 7770e06..123ebd3 100644
--- a/src/reader/pe_read_optional_header.c
+++ b/src/reader/pe_read_optional_header.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<endian.h>
#include <string.h>
diff --git a/src/reader/pe_read_section_header.c b/src/reader/pe_read_section_header.c
index 280c611..e7c5d2f 100644
--- a/src/reader/pe_read_section_header.c
+++ b/src/reader/pe_read_section_header.c
@@ -1,3 +1,9 @@
+/***************************************************************/
+/* perk: PE Resource Kit */
+/* Copyright (C) 2015--2016 Z. Gilboa */
+/* Released under GPLv2 and GPLv3; see COPYING.PERK. */
+/***************************************************************/
+
#include <endian.h>
#include <string.h>